Where is Thon Hotel Linne, Oslo?

Where is Thon Hotel Linne, Oslo located?

Thon Hotel Linne, Oslo, Thon Hotel Linne, Oslo, Norway (approx. 59.93949°, 10.82897°)


Where is Thon Hotel Linne, Oslo on the map?